This is a Validated Antibody Database (VAD) review about mouse Trp53, based on 337 published articles (read how Labome selects the articles), using Trp53 antibody in all methods. It is aimed to help Labome visitors find the most suited Trp53 antibody. Please note the number of articles fluctuates since newly identified citations are added and citations for discontinued catalog numbers are removed regularly.
Trp53 synonym: Tp53; bbl; bfy; bhy; p44; p53
